  • Patent number: 7755019
    Abstract: An auto darkening eye protection device comprising a shutter assembly and a control circuit in electrical communication with the shutter assembly. The shutter assembly is adjustable between a clear state and a dark state. The control circuit comprises a microcontroller programmed to store a plurality of memory presets including at least one setting corresponding to the operation of the shutter assembly. At least two of the plurality of memory presets are individually configured for a specific type of welding. In another embodiment, an auto darkening eye protection device is provided, the device comprising a shutter assembly and a control circuit in electrical communication with the shutter assembly. The shutter assembly is adjustable between a clear state and a dark state. The control circuit comprises a microcontroller programmed to monitor and store at least one parameter corresponding to the operation of the auto darkening eye protection device.

  • Patent number: 7232988
    Abstract: An auto darkening eye protection device comprising a shutter assembly adjustable between a clear state and a dark state and a control circuit. The control circuit is provided with a microcontroller, a delivery circuit, a sensing circuit and a weld detect circuit. The microcontroller is switchable between a sleep mode and a wake-up mode. The delivery circuit outputs a dark state drive signal to the shutter assembly to switch the shutter assembly from the clear state to the dark state upon enablement of the delivery circuit. The sensing circuit senses the occurrence of a welding arc and provides an output indicative of the occurrence of the welding arc. The weld detect circuit receives the output of the sensing circuit.
